Fuel Saver Chip - do they work?

seen a seller on ebay offering a chip to improve fuel economy, hp, etc.

says it is a "chip" some of his neg feedback claim it is only a resistor and does no good.

Are there any "chips" that do work? are they street legal, etc?

It's complete crap. It's fact that they don't work. Just to be 100% sure I bought one, and made it switchable. My car was noticeably slower with it and I'm sure my gas consumption was way up when that thing was on. It's basically a 50 cent resistor that "fools" your computer. I think the Honda engineers knew a little more than some guy who knows how to solder and has a Ebay account. Save your 5$ for gas.
